I've been playing a lot of platformers lately but something about **Spiny & Chilly** really grabbed me โ€” it's one of those delightfully wacky games where the whole premise is just "you play as a penguin with a hedgehog on your head and together you're hunting for ice." Seriously, some other penguins have stolen all the world's ice blocks (forโ€ฆ reasons?), so Chilly has to team up with Spiny and explore this somewhat large open-ish world in search of them. They move together as if they were one character โ€” it feels cohesive rather than gimmicky!

This game was shown at BIG Conference where I saw a demo, and the developer was genuinely passionate about what they'd built (you can almost feel that love for their creations just radiating through). It's heavily inspired by collecting-focused classics like **Banjo-Kazooie** and **Super Mario 64**, which is always music to my ears. There are little puzzles scattered everywhere, secrets tucked away in odd corners, and tons of ice blocks waiting to be claimed โ€” the sense of satisfaction from finally climbing a tower or reaching that hard-to-grab piece was honestly pretty incredible on first try.

The world areas felt really interesting too (I spotted haunted harbors and floating islands just in my demo run) and there are some cool mechanics like bouncing off platforms, gravity shifts, and helpful items to grab along the way. The only small thing I noticed is that sometimes it feels a bit too spacious between regions โ€” could use maybe more visual landmarks so you don't get lost wandering across those large empty stretches โ€” but as an early demo this was incredibly promising for what's yet to come! **Currently in development, and already worth adding to your Steam wishlist** if collecting games are right up your alley.
